Using newly manufactured 10-frame hive bodies creates a sterile, controlled baseline essential for accurate scientific assessment. By utilizing fresh equipment, researchers ensure that data regarding colony health and medication efficacy is not skewed by residual chemicals, historical pathogens, or physical inconsistencies found in used gear.
Scientific accuracy depends on isolating the variable you are testing. New hive bodies provide a "blank slate," ensuring that observations regarding queen supersedure, overwintering survival, and treatment effects are a direct result of the intervention, rather than interference from previous contamination.
Eliminating Environmental Interference
To accurately assess how a colony responds to a medication or environmental factor, you must remove "ghost variables" from the equation.
removing Chemical Residues
Wood is porous and can absorb chemicals over time. Used hive bodies often retain residues from previous mite treatments or agricultural pesticides.
If you use old equipment, it becomes impossible to tell if a colony’s decline is due to a new medication being tested or a toxic interaction with old chemicals leaching from the wood. New bodies eliminate this risk entirely.
Preventing Pathogen Carryover
Honeybee pathogens, such as bacterial spores or fungal elements, can survive in hive material for long periods.
Starting with new manufacturing ensures the environment is free of historical disease load. This allows for a clear evaluation of colony health based solely on current conditions and treatments, rather than past outbreaks.
Establishing Uniform Test Conditions
Beyond cleanliness, the validity of a study relies on the ability to make "apples-to-apples" comparisons between different colonies.
Consistent Physical Space
The standard 10-frame hive offers a fixed volume for the colony to occupy. This ensures that every experimental group is developing under identical physical space conditions.
When evaluating growth-stimulating agents, it is vital that no colony has an unfair advantage or disadvantage due to warped, modified, or non-standard equipment often seen in older gear.
Accurate Resource Monitoring
Standardization simplifies the collection of data.
When the living environment is uniform, researchers can objectively measure and compare critical metrics. This includes the quantity of sealed brood, colony strength, and the storage rates of pollen and honey across different test groups.
Understanding the Trade-offs
While using new equipment is the gold standard for research, it introduces specific constraints that must be acknowledged.
The "Sterile Lab" vs. Reality
New hives represent an idealized environment. Data gathered in pristine, new boxes provides high internal validity (accuracy for the specific test) but may have lower external validity (applicability to the real world).
Most commercial operations rely on used equipment. Therefore, results observed in new hives might differ slightly from what a beekeeper experiences in an older apiary with established chemical baselines.
Resource Intensity
Replacing hive bodies for every assessment is capital intensive.
This approach prioritizes data integrity over economy. For general management, this level of rigor is unnecessary, but for medication assessment, the cost of new equipment is justified by the prevention of corrupted data.
Making the Right Choice for Your Goal
The decision to use new vs. used equipment depends entirely on the precision required by your objectives.
- If your primary focus is Controlled Research: You must use new hive bodies to isolate variables and ensure that survival rates and supersedure data are statistically valid.
- If your primary focus is General Production: You can utilize used equipment, provided it is inspected for structural integrity, though it is not suitable for testing new chemical treatments.
In the context of scientific assessment, the purity of the environment is just as critical as the treatment being tested.
